Cost of ABS Module Replacement: What to Expect

Replacing your car's ABS unit can be a substantial outlay, with prices ranging widely. Usually, labor charges account for a major portion of the complete estimate. You might expect paying anywhere from $300 to $1,500 or even higher, depending on the make and model of your automobile . Sections themselves can also run between $150 and $800, although top-quality replacements usually more costly. Troubleshooting time, if necessary, will boost to the final price as well, so getting a precise quote from a reputable mechanic is vital.

ABS Control Module Replacement: Restoring Your Braking Performance

A damaged ABS control computer can seriously affect your vehicle's safety capabilities. Substituting the ABS control module is often the required fix when you encounter warning signals on your dashboard related to the anti-lock stopping . This task typically involves detaching the old component , mounting the new one, and then initializing it to work properly with your vehicle's present electronic structure.
